TrinIT Talent are looking for an Enterprise Architect to join our customer on a 12-month Fixed Term Contract. This role is primarily remote with very occasional travel and is paying £80,000 per annum.
As an Enterprise Architect, you will play a key role in shaping the future technology landscape across a large-scale public sector transformation programme. You will work with senior stakeholders to define strategic architecture, develop technology roadmaps, and ensure digital initiatives align with long-term organisational objectives. You will provide architectural leadership across multiple workstreams, helping to drive interoperability, modernisation, and the adoption of shared digital capabilities. The role requires a blend of strategic thinking, technical expertise, and stakeholder engagement to support major organisational change and transformation initiatives.
Key skills:
- Extensive experience as an Enterprise Architect, Lead Architect or Principal Architect
- TOGAF certified (or equivalent Enterprise Architecture framework)
- Strong understanding of Enterprise Architecture principles, standards and governance
- Experience developing architecture roadmaps, target state architectures and technology strategies
